FIFA Mobile Soccer (Now EA Sports FC Mobile): Full Player Guide

FIFA Mobile Soccer was rebranded to EA Sports FC Mobile back in 2023, after EA and FIFA ended their long-running licensing partnership, but the game underneath is the same squad-building, match-simulating experience longtime players already know. If you searched for FIFA Mobile Soccer expecting the old name in the app store, you'll land on EA Sports FC Mobile instead, currently sitting around version 26 with the same core structure: build a team of real footballers, run them through quick VS Attack matches, and grind through seasonal events to upgrade your squad.

I've played through several seasons of this franchise on both Android and iOS, and what strikes me every time is how much EA has leaned into short match sessions. A single VS Attack possession lasts maybe 60 to 90 seconds, which makes the whole thing feel built for commute-length play rather than a full 90-minute sim. That single design choice is what separates it from console FIFA and is worth understanding before you download anything.

What Happened to FIFA Mobile Soccer?

FIFA Mobile Soccer no longer exists under that name. Electronic Arts rebranded the entire mobile lineup to EA Sports FC after its licensing deal with FIFA lapsed, and the mobile title became EA Sports FC Mobile in 2023, with the app now on its 26th seasonal edition. The gameplay, currency systems, and menu layout carried over almost untouched, so anyone who played FIFA Mobile in 2022 will recognize FC Mobile instantly.

In practice this means old download links or APKs labeled FIFA Mobile Soccer are outdated builds. If you install one, expect broken servers or missing rosters, because live events and card databases only get pushed to the current app package.

How Do You Download FC Mobile?

FC Mobile is available as a free installer from Google Play on Android and the App Store on iOS, published directly by Electronic Arts under the developer name EA Sports FC. On Android the file size runs well over 100 MB, and you'll want another few hundred MB of free storage for post-install downloads, since match assets and stadium textures get pulled in after the first launch.

For those who'd rather skip a phone install entirely, browser-based cloud gaming services let you stream FC Mobile from a PC without downloading the full package, though performance depends heavily on your connection. I've tested this route on a laptop with average broadband and input lag was noticeable during fast dribbling sequences, so competitive players are better off on native mobile hardware.

How Do You Play FC Mobile Online?

FC Mobile online play happens through Head to Head and VS Attack modes, both of which pit your squad against another human's roster in real time over a live server connection. You need an active internet connection and, ideally, a linked EA account so your progress and purchased packs sync across devices.

What trips up new players in online modes is possession pacing. VS Attack splits a match into alternating attacking turns rather than continuous 90-minute play, so you get one chance to score before defense flips to your opponent. Learning to manage the shot clock inside that turn matters more early on than knowing every attacking move.

Can You Play FC Mobile Offline?

Yes, FC Mobile includes offline-capable modes such as Manager Career and single-player Campaign matches against AI opponents, which don't require a live match connection once the app and its assets are downloaded. This makes it a reasonable option for flights or areas with spotty signal.

Offline progress still needs periodic syncing though. Season rewards, live events, and market trading are all server-based, so you'll want to reconnect regularly or you'll fall behind players who are grinding daily online content.

What Are the Best Early Tips for New Players?

New FC Mobile players get the fastest improvement by focusing on a short list of fundamentals rather than chasing every event at once. The best players I've seen in the community all built discipline around these basics before worrying about rare card pulls.

Useful early habits include:

  • Complete daily login and training drills before spending stamina on random matches, since they hand out guaranteed currency
  • Prioritize chemistry between players from the same league or nation over raw individual ratings
  • Save currency for guaranteed campaign packs instead of blind gacha-style pulls early on
  • Practice timed finishing in training mode before relying on it in ranked VS Attack
  • Rotate your starting eleven based on stamina rather than always fielding your five strongest cards

How Does Squad Building Work in FC Mobile?

Squad building in FC Mobile revolves around collecting player cards, upgrading them with training points, and matching chemistry bonuses across league, nation, and club affiliations. EA's official messaging puts the pool at over 18,000 players across more than 690 teams, giving you a genuinely deep roster to pull from compared to most mobile sports titles.

The part that separates good squads from mediocre ones isn't rating numbers, it's chemistry math. A 91-rated card sitting outside your chemistry links plays worse in a match than an 84-rated card that's fully linked in. I'd rather field a cohesive back line of mid-tier defenders than mix in one flashy card that breaks the chain.

What Modes Does the Game Offer?

FC Mobile organizes its content into a handful of distinct modes that rotate emphasis depending on the live season. Each targets a different play style, from quick competitive bursts to longer management sessions.

Current modes include:

  • VS Attack, the fast head-to-head mode built around alternating attacking turns
  • Head to Head, a closer approximation of full match play against real opponents
  • Manager Career, an offline-friendly progression mode against AI
  • Live seasonal events tied to real-world tournaments and league calendars
  • Market and auction house trading for buying and selling player cards

Frequently Asked Questions

Is FIFA Mobile Soccer still available to download?

Not under that name. It was rebranded to EA Sports FC Mobile in 2023 and that's the app you'll find in current app stores, now up to its 26th edition.

Is FC Mobile free to play?

The app itself is free to install, though it includes optional in-game purchases for virtual currency and player packs, some of which involve randomized rewards.

Can I play FC Mobile on PC?

There's no official PC client, but browser-based cloud gaming services let you stream the Android version without installing it locally, at the cost of some input latency.

Do I need internet access to play?

Only for online modes like VS Attack and Head to Head. Manager Career and campaign matches against AI work without a live connection once the app is installed.

Why did FIFA Mobile change its name?

Electronic Arts lost the rights to the FIFA branding after its licensing agreement with FIFA ended, so the entire product line, including the mobile game, moved to the EA Sports FC name.
